316 stainless steel flange
Product Characteristics:

316 stainless steel flange is a disc-shaped component made of 316 stainless steel, mainly used for connecting equipment such as pipelines, valves, pumps, and containers. Two flanges are tightly connected by bolts and other fasteners to achieve sealing and connection of pipelines or equipment. Here is a detailed introduction about it:

Material characteristics

Corrosion resistance: 316 stainless steel has excellent corrosion resistance, atmospheric corrosion resistance, and high temperature strength due to the addition of molybdenum (Mo) element. It can be used under harsh conditions, such as equipment used in seawater, chemicals, dyes, papermaking, oxalic acid, fertilizers, and other production equipment.

Mechanical properties: Tensile strength not less than 620MPa, yield strength not less than 310MPa, elongation not less than 30%, area reduction not less than 40%, with good toughness and strength.

Specifications and Dimensions

316 stainless steel flanges come in various specifications and sizes, commonly including DN10-DN2000, covering different nominal diameters to meet the connection needs of various pipeline systems. There are also various pressure levels, such as PN0.6, PN1.0, PN1.6, etc., which can adapt to different pressure environments.

Application field

Industrial field: widely used in industries such as chemical, petroleum, papermaking, food, etc., for connecting pipelines and equipment with various corrosive media.

In the field of shipbuilding, due to its excellent resistance to seawater corrosion, it is commonly used for pipeline connections in shipbuilding.

In the field of architecture, 316 stainless steel flanges are also used to connect and seal pipelines in systems such as air conditioning refrigeration and construction machinery.

Installation key points

During installation, two flanges should be placed on both sides of the pipeline or equipment interface to ensure accurate hole alignment. Gaskets should be embedded between the flanges, and then bolts should be used to tightly connect the flanges. When tightening bolts, the diagonal sequence should be followed, and uniform force should be applied to ensure the sealing between flanges, followed by sealing inspection.
